Where Are Halara Pants Manufactured

Halara is a women's activewear brand that sells leggings, joggers, and lounge pants online. The company designs and markets its apparel from offices in the United States, while the physical manufacturing is primarily handled by third-party factories in China and other parts of Asia. Halara does not operate its own large-scale garment plants but relies on contract manufacturers to produce its pants at scale. This model allows the brand to offer affordable price points while maintaining a lean corporate structure.

The brand's supply chain is built around sourcing fabrics and finished garments from manufacturers that can meet specific quality and cost targets. Halara lists materials such as polyester, spandex, and nylon blends in its product descriptions, which are commonly sourced from global textile mills. The finished pants are assembled in factories that specialize in stretch activewear and then shipped directly to consumers through e-commerce channels. This setup keeps inventory costs low and allows the company to respond quickly to demand trends.

Halara Supply Chain and Production Partners

Primary Manufacturing Regions

The majority of Halara pants are produced in China, where the company's contract manufacturers operate large-scale sewing and finishing facilities. China remains a dominant hub for activewear production due to its integrated textile supply chains, skilled workforce, and established factory infrastructure. Halara's product pages and shipping details indicate that orders are fulfilled from warehouses that handle goods sourced from these Asian production centers.

In addition to China, some Halara products may be manufactured in other countries within the broader Asian manufacturing belt. The brand uses multiple production partners to balance capacity, cost, and lead times. Halara's fulfillment process involves consolidating finished pants from these partners and shipping them to regional distribution centers before reaching customers. This multi-source approach helps the brand manage inventory and reduce delays during peak demand periods.

Material Sourcing and Fabric Origins

Halara pants use synthetic fabric blends that rely on raw materials sourced from various regions, including petrochemical-based polyester and spandex. The initial textile production for these fabrics often takes place in large mills in Asia before being cut and sewn into garments at Halara's contract factories. The brand emphasizes stretch, moisture-wicking, and four-way flexibility in its fabric specifications.

Halara Brand Background and Business Model

Company Structure and Ownership

Halara operates as a digitally native activewear brand that sells directly to consumers through its website and online marketplaces. The company is part of a broader group of e-commerce brands that use social media marketing and influencer partnerships to drive sales. Halara's business model focuses on trend-driven designs and competitive pricing, with production scaled according to demand forecasts.

The brand's operations are structured to minimize overhead by outsourcing manufacturing and relying on third-party logistics providers for shipping and fulfillment. Halara's corporate team handles design, marketing, and customer service, while production is managed by external factory partners. This model is common among direct-to-consumer apparel brands and allows Halara to maintain a lean cost structure while offering a wide range of pants and activewear styles.
